在 2018/10/22 下午8:17, Thomas Huth 写道:
On 2018-10-22 10:02, Yi Min Zhao wrote:
Common function measurement block is used to report counters of
successfully issued pcilg/stg/stb and rpcit instructions. This patch
introduces a new struct ZpciFmb and schedules a timer callback to
copy fmb to the guest memory at a interval time which is set to
4s by default. While attemping to update fmb failed, an event error
would be generated. After pcilg/stg/stb and rpcit interception
handlers issue successfully, increase the related counter. The guest
could pass null address to switch off FMB and stop corresponding
timer.

+static int fmb_do_update(S390PCIBusDevice *pbdev, uint8_t offset, int len)
+{
+    MemTxResult ret;
+
+    ret = address_space_write(&address_space_memory,
+                              pbdev->fmb_addr + (uint64_t)offset,
+                              MEMTXATTRS_UNSPECIFIED,
+                              (uint8_t *)&pbdev->fmb + offset,
+                              len);
+    if (ret) {
+        s390_pci_generate_error_event(ERR_EVENT_FMBA, pbdev->fh, pbdev->fid,
+                                      pbdev->fmb_addr, 0);
+        fmb_timer_free(pbdev);
+    }
+
+    return ret;
+}
+
+static void fmb_update(void *opaque)
+{
+    S390PCIBusDevice *pbdev = opaque;
+    int64_t t = qemu_clock_get_ms(QEMU_CLOCK_VIRTUAL);
+    uint8_t offset = offsetof(ZpciFmb, last_update);
+
+    /* Update U bit */
+    pbdev->fmb.last_update |= UPDATE_U_BIT;
+    if (fmb_do_update(pbdev, offset, sizeof(uint64_t))) {
+        return;
+    }
+
+    /* Update FMB counters */
+    pbdev->fmb.sample++;
+    if (fmb_do_update(pbdev, 0, sizeof(ZpciFmb))) {
+        return;
+    }
+
+    /* Clear U bit and update the time */
+    pbdev->fmb.last_update = time2tod(qemu_clock_get_ns(QEMU_CLOCK_VIRTUAL));
+    pbdev->fmb.last_update &= ~UPDATE_U_BIT;
+    if (fmb_do_update(pbdev, offset, sizeof(uint64_t))) {
+        return;
+    }
+
+    timer_mod(pbdev->fmb_timer, t + DEFAULT_MUI);
+}
Sorry for noticing this in v1 already, but is this code endianess-safe?
I.e. can this also work with qemu-system-s390x running with TCG on a x86
host? I think you might have to use something like this here instead:

   pbdev->fmb.sample = cpu_to_be32(be32_to_cpu(pbdev->fmb.sample) + 1);

etc.

  Thomas


Aha!!! Yes, I think you're right. Indeed, we should consider endianess.
